The role of food packaging in modern society cannot be overstated, as it serves as a crucial barrier between the food product and the external environment, thereby ensuring the food remains fresh for a longer period. Conventional food packaging plastics have been widely used due to their sturdiness and effectiveness in preventing oxygen from reaching the food, which is a primary cause of spoilage. By keeping oxygen out, these plastics help to slow down the degradation process, allowing food to be stored for extended periods without significant loss of quality or nutritional value.
The use of conventional food packaging plastics has become an integral part of the food supply chain, enabling the widespread distribution of perishable goods across different regions. The ability of these plastics to maintain the freshness and quality of food products has contributed significantly to reducing food waste and improving food security. Furthermore, the extended shelf life provided by these plastics has also facilitated the global trade of food products, making it possible for consumers to access a diverse range of food items throughout the year.
